We follow a proven 6-step process to ensure your project is completed on time, on budget, and exceeds expectations.
We assist in selecting durable flooring, inspect and repair the subfloor, ensuring it's clean, dry, and level for installation
Existing flooring is removed and disposed of, then appropriate underlayment is installed, such as cement board or moisture barrier
We plan the layout to minimize small pieces, establish guidelines, and dry-lay the pattern to visualize the final result
Tiles are set with thinset and leveling systems, while LVP and hardwood are clicked, glued, or nailed, with precise cuts around obstacles
Grout is applied to tile, excess is cleaned, and lines are sealed, while trim and transitions are installed for other floors
Grout lines and natural stone are sealed, baseboards are installed, and the area is thoroughly cleaned to ensure customer satisfaction

For durability, consider porcelain or ceramic tile, which can last decades, or luxury vinyl plank for comfort and resilience, while avoiding hardwood due to water damage risks

Typically, cabinets are installed first, followed by flooring, but islands require flooring underneath for future flexibility, our experts advise on the best approach for your project
Medium-toned neutrals, such as gray and greige, are practical choices, hiding dirt and wear, and complementing various cabinet styles, popular in many Arlington homes
